After undergoing Ultherapy in Hobart, it's crucial to follow specific post-treatment guidelines to ensure optimal results and minimize potential risks. Here are some key points to avoid:
Avoid Direct Sun Exposure: Direct sunlight can cause skin irritation and potentially affect the healing process. It's advisable to stay out of the sun or use a high-SPF sunscreen if exposure is unavoidable.
Do Not Apply Makeup Immediately: Applying makeup too soon after the procedure can introduce bacteria to the treated area, increasing the risk of infection. It's recommended to wait at least 24 hours before using any cosmetics.
Avoid Hot Baths or Saunas: Engaging in activities that raise your body temperature, such as hot baths or saunas, can interfere with the healing process and may cause discomfort. Stick to lukewarm water for bathing.
Do Not Massage the Treated Area: Massaging the treated skin can disrupt the healing process and potentially reduce the effectiveness of the treatment. Allow the area to heal naturally without any additional pressure or manipulation.
Avoid Strenuous Exercise: Engaging in intense physical activity can increase blood flow and potentially cause swelling or discomfort. It's best to avoid strenuous exercises for at least a few days post-treatment.
Do Not Ignore Any Signs of Infection: If you notice any signs of infection, such as excessive redness, swelling, or discharge, contact your healthcare provider immediately. Prompt attention can prevent complications.

Avoiding Direct Sun Exposure
After undergoing Ultherapy in Hobart, it is crucial to take proper care of your skin to ensure the best results and minimize any potential side effects. One of the most important steps is to avoid direct sunlight. The skin is more sensitive post-treatment, and exposure to UV rays can lead to irritation, redness, and even hyperpigmentation. To protect your skin, always apply a high SPF sunscreen, ideally one that offers broad-spectrum protection against both UVA and UVB rays. This will help shield your skin from harmful sun damage and promote healing.
Refraining from Harsh Skincare Products
Another key aspect of post-Ultherapy care is to avoid using harsh skincare products. This includes exfoliants, retinoids, and any products containing alcohol or strong acids. These can further irritate the skin and delay the healing process. Instead, opt for gentle, soothing products that are specifically formulated for sensitive skin. Look for ingredients like aloe vera, chamomile, and hyaluronic acid, which can help calm and hydrate the skin without causing additional irritation.
Avoiding Heat and Sweating
Engaging in activities that cause excessive sweating or exposure to heat should also be avoided after Ultherapy. This includes hot yoga, saunas, and strenuous workouts. The increased blood flow and heat can exacerbate any swelling or redness and may interfere with the treatment's effectiveness. It's best to stick to mild exercise and keep the environment cool to allow your skin to heal properly.
Not Picking or Scratching the Skin
It's important to resist the urge to pick or scratch at the treated area, even if you experience mild itching or discomfort. Picking at the skin can lead to infection, scarring, and other complications. If you feel the need to alleviate any discomfort, apply a cool compress or use a gentle moisturizer to soothe the area. Patience is key during the healing process, and allowing your skin to recover naturally will yield the best results.

Avoiding Immediate Makeup Application
One of the most important steps to take after Ultherapy is to avoid applying makeup for at least 24 hours. This is not just a recommendation; it's a critical measure to protect the treated area from bacterial infections. The skin is particularly vulnerable immediately after the procedure, and any introduction of makeup, which can harbor bacteria, could lead to unwanted infections. By waiting a full day before using cosmetics, you significantly reduce the risk of such complications.
The Science Behind the Wait
The reason for this 24-hour waiting period is rooted in the nature of the Ultherapy procedure itself. Ultherapy uses ultrasound energy to stimulate collagen production deep within the skin. This process can cause temporary redness, swelling, and sensitivity on the surface. During this time, the skin's natural barrier function is somewhat compromised, making it easier for bacteria to penetrate and cause infections. By avoiding makeup, you allow your skin to begin its natural healing process without the added risk of contamination.
Practical Tips for Post-Procedure Skincare
To further enhance your post-Ultherapy skincare routine, consider the following tips: - Use only gentle, fragrance-free cleansers to wash your face. - Apply a soothing moisturizer to keep the skin hydrated. - Avoid direct sun exposure and use a broad-spectrum sunscreen if you need to be outdoors. - Refrain from using any harsh exfoliants or retinoids for at least a week after the procedure.

Avoiding Hot Baths and Saunas
Immediately after Ultherapy, your skin will be more sensitive and prone to irritation. Engaging in activities that raise your body temperature, such as hot baths or saunas, can exacerbate this sensitivity and potentially lead to complications. The heat from these activities can cause blood vessels to dilate, which might interfere with the natural healing process and could result in unnecessary discomfort or swelling.
Choosing Warm Water Baths
In contrast, a warm water bath can be a soothing and beneficial option. Warm water helps to relax the muscles and can alleviate any minor discomfort you might feel post-treatment. It also aids in maintaining cleanliness, which is crucial to prevent any infections that could hinder the healing process. By choosing a warm water bath, you are supporting your body's natural recovery mechanisms without risking any adverse effects.
